Feb 26, 2015 · We need to learn how to practice emotional first aid. Here are 7 ways to do so: Pay attention to emotional pain — recognize it when it happens and work to treat it before it feels all-encompassing.
Too many of us deal with common psychological-health issues on our own, says Guy Winch. But we don't have to. He makes a compelling case to practice emotional hygiene — taking care of our emotions, our minds, with the same diligence we take care of our bodies.
